package javax.swing.text;
import java.awt.*;
import javax.swing.event.*;
/**
* A LabelView
is a styled chunk of text
* that represents a view mapped over an element in the
* text model. It caches the character level attributes
* used for rendering.
*
* @author Timothy Prinzing
* @version 1.68 06/28/04
*/
public class LabelView extends GlyphView implements TabableView {
/**
* Constructs a new view wrapped on an element.
*
* @param elem the element
*/
public LabelView(Element elem) {
super(elem);
}
/**
* Synchronize the view's cached values with the model.
* This causes the font, metrics, color, etc to be
* re-cached if the cache has been invalidated.
*/
final void sync() {
if (font == null) {
setPropertiesFromAttributes();
}
}

/**
* Sets the background color for the view. This method is typically
* invoked as part of configuring this View
. If you need
* to customize the background color you should override
* setPropertiesFromAttributes
and invoke this method. A
* value of null indicates no background should be rendered, so that the
* background of the parent View
will show through.
*
* @param bg background color, or null
* @see #setPropertiesFromAttributes
* @since 1.5
*/
protected void setBackground(Color bg) {
this.bg = bg;
}
/**
* Sets the cached properties from the attributes.
*/
protected void setPropertiesFromAttributes() {
AttributeSet attr = getAttributes();
if (attr != null) {
Document d = getDocument();
if (d instanceof StyledDocument) {
StyledDocument doc = (StyledDocument) d;
font = doc.getFont(attr);
fg = doc.getForeground(attr);
if (attr.isDefined(StyleConstants.Background)) {
bg = doc.getBackground(attr);
} else {
bg = null;
}
setUnderline(StyleConstants.isUnderline(attr));
setStrikeThrough(StyleConstants.isStrikeThrough(attr));
setSuperscript(StyleConstants.isSuperscript(attr));
setSubscript(StyleConstants.isSubscript(attr));
} else {
throw new StateInvariantError("LabelView needs StyledDocument");
}
}
}
